Which of the following shows the maximum rise in temperature? (a) 23° to 32° (b) – 10° to + 1° (c) – 18° to – 11° (d) – 5° to 5°

Option (b) is correct here
As the difference in the temperature = 1°–(10°) = 11° (maximum) Whereas,
23° to 32° = 32° - 23° = 9°
–18° to–11° = -11° - (-18)°
= 7°
–5° to 5° = 5° - (-5)°
= 10°
